Output 98fc1cda33753b3a956fc81abcc114d8ac32b3075c636462591860aecc2cf00f:0

value
1266068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8cfc8f9a6005ff8a7d6e073e3b0d103c754acbb OP_EQUAL
address
3JYDAzvpWqmHoxuGYajE2RWrf1jzFcmxZY
transaction
98fc1cda33753b3a956fc81abcc114d8ac32b3075c636462591860aecc2cf00f
spent
true